Binary package “oping” in ubuntu xenial
sends ICMP_ECHO requests to network hosts
oping uses ICMP packages (better known as "ping packets") to test the
reachability of network hosts. It supports pinging multiple hosts in parallel
using IPv4 and/or IPv6 transparently.
.
This package contains two command line applications: "oping" is a replacement
for tools like ping(1), ping6(1) and fping(1). "noping" is an ncurses-based
tool which displays statistics while pinging and highlights aberrant
round-trip times.
